Job Description
We are seeking a highly organized and proactive Production Coordinator to join our manufacturing plant in East Leake. This role will be pivotal in ensuring production schedules are met, monitoring production shortages daily, and ensuring resources are effectively utilized.
Key Responsibilities
- Coordinate daily production schedules to meet delivery requirements and internal targets.
- Monitor production progress, identifying and addressing any delays or issues impacting production timelines.
- Create and update daily work order shortage sheets.
- Release work orders for picking by the stores team.
- Create sales order pick lists.
- Generate update reports for delivery centers that lack visibility of the MRP system.
- Liaise with procurement, planning, and warehouse teams to ensure materials and components are available to meet production and sales order needs.
- Assist with capacity planning and allocation of labor resources to maintain workflow.
- Maintain accurate records of production data, including output, downtime, and rework.
- Communicate effectively with cross-functional teams, including engineering, quality, and procurement, to resolve issues promptly.
- Support and own the implementation of continuous improvement initiatives across production processes.
- Ensure adherence to health and safety standards and company policies on the production floor.
Required Skills and Experience
- Previous experience in a manufacturing or electronics production environment.
- Experience in production planning, coordination, or scheduling roles.
- Strong organizational and time management skills with the ability to prioritize tasks effectively.
- Excellent problem-solving abilities and attention to detail.
- Strong pro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, especially Excel; experience with ERP systems is desirable.
- Good ver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to collaborate with multiple teams.
- Continuous improvement mindset with a desire to improve processes.
- Understanding of quality and health & safety practices in a manufacturing environment.
- Ability to adapt to changing production demands and work under pressure.
